Which of the following factors help to explain the sustained increases in health care spending in the United States, and which do not?
a.the additional paperwork, duplication, and waste generated in the U.S.health care system compared to systems in other countries
b.the increasing costs of malpractice insurance and malpractice lawsuit settlements
c.the number of uninsured patients receiving hospital treatment that could have been performed at a lower cost in doctors' offices
d.the slow growth in labor productivity in health care compared to that in the economy as a whole
e.the aging population
f.increases in the cost of providing health care
Deferred Imitation
The ability to remember and replicate actions observed at an earlier time, without the model being present.
Months of Age
A measurement of time used to specify how old someone or something is in months, often applied to infants and young children.
Piaget
Swiss psychologist Jean Piaget is known for his theory on the cognitive development of children, identifying stages of mental growth from infancy to adolescence.
